Transaction 13377243356d9a818aa71a6edef814d0adcd97022519211075edbd58a420cf2d
1 Input
1 Output
-
13377243356d9a818aa71a6edef814d0adcd97022519211075edbd58a420cf2d:0
- value
- 343893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05eb425ebb27346926c6f5b61daf43f287b017b2 OP_EQUAL
- address
- 32EK8bunwibmgrHomNcCqABwp7aQg1745p